13 13 (in billions) $93.1 billion in Brand Drugs Off-Patent from 2008-2015 2008: Risperdal, Lamictal, Fosamax, Imitrex 2009: Adderall, Prevacid, Topamax, Valtrex 2010: Effexor XR, Flomax, Cozaar, Hyzaar 2011: Lipitor, Actos, Protonix, Zyprexa, Levaquin, Aricept 2012: Plavix, Singulair, Seroquel, Lexapro, Diovan, Avandia 2013: Cymbalta, Celebrex, Aciphex 2014: Nexium, Vytorin, Zetia, Lyrica, Nasonex 2015: Abilify 13 2009 Generics—The Calm Before the Storm
